Paul Briggs resigns, criticizes AFL's Indigenous blueprint for lacking depth

Paul Briggs, the former chair of the AFL's Indigenous Advisory Council, resigned last year, condemning the new Indigenous blueprint as shallow and self-centered. Alongside fellow directors, he felt disrespected after the council was overlooked in developing the plan. Briggs called for increased support for Indigenous players and more inclusion in AFL decisions.
